The Eiderdown Chronicles continue…

She's dead, married and looking for new business. Lillian Eiderdown and her swain, Roscoe Entwhistle are enjoying their afterlife to the fullest thanks to a growing clientele among the departed. Here is a taste of what's ahead for the crafty founders of the Entwhistle-Eiderdown Agency.

Eiderdown Two: Mrs. Winstead’s Swansong

As much as she loves her new husband, Lillian is bored by their leisurely afterlife. The transparent pair return to West Hill to open the Entwhistle-Eiderdown agency, a business dedicated to tying up loose ends for the dead. Thank heavens the famous Penelope Winstead is dying to meet them. Can the agency help the artist before her son loses his legacy?

Eiderdown Three: Young Simmons’s Overdue Situation

Young Simmons, West Hill’s oldest library page, has passed away leaving a problem under the floorboards. The Entwhistle-Eiderdown Agency knows just who to look up to solve the dilemma, but can Lillian and Roscoe help the poor ghost without breaking his heart for all eternity?

Eiderdown Four: Mr. Littlefield’s New Occupation

A new tenant has moved into the shop formerly known as Entwhistle-Eiderdown Wools. The West Hill Eiderdownians are ecstatic. Madame Evangeline claims she can channel the dead, but what will Lillian and Roscoe say when a scoundrel from Madame’s past turns up dead and ready to spoil the show?

Eiderdown Five: Mrs. Langstrom’s Proper Replacement

Dianda Langstrom, West Hill’s favorite teacher, is dead and frantic to find her replacement before school starts. Can the Entwhistle-Eiderdown Agency influence a proper substitute in time or will the job fall to little Sophie’s mother, an efficiency expert in need of a hug? And what is up the silken sleeve of Sophie’s Aunt Merry?
